Abstract:
A highway marker for attachment to a roadbed to signal the location of a lane extending longitudinally of the roadbed and to signal the proper direction of movement in a traffic lane while defining the boundaries of the traffic lane. The marker has a bottom surface for attachment to a roadbed, a base and adjacent sides are perpendicularly arranged to the base and describe the boundaries of a triangle. A triangular floor in the form of a triangle has a base coincident with the perpendicular base and sides spaced inwardly from the perpendicular sides with there being a peeked boundary formed between the perpendicular adjacent sides and the adjacent sides of the floor. A reflective surface on the perpendicular adjacent sides form an arrow indicating a direction of travel while another reflective surface on the floor indicates an opposite direction of travel respective to the first arrow and can be of various colors.
Abstract:
A self adjusting plug is provided that is adapted to be removeably held in place within openings of different sizes in order to plug such openings is provided. The self adjusting plug comprises a top portion having a first and second side, a shaft portion, having a first and second end, the first end of the shaft portion being connected to the first side of the top portion, and one or more projections attached to the shaft portion and extending outwardly from the shaft portion. The self adjusting plug is used to plug openings by passing the bottom end of the plug into the first end of the opening, forcing the projections of the bottom end of the plug to flex as they contact the wall of the opening, to create a friction fit between the projections of the plug and the walls defining the opening.
Abstract:
An enclosed trailer for towing by an over the road truck is provided having increased internal width for a given external width. The side walls of the trailer are constructed from a series of vertically extending, spaced apart, rigid plates, preferably metallic plates, and metallic reinforcing members which have an inwardly projecting, vertically extending rib that is positioned between the adjacent edges of adjacent pairs of plates. The reinforcing members are riveted or otherwise rigidly secured to the outside of a pair of plates. Furthermore, the plates and reinforcing members are also rigidly secured to vertically extending flanges of the longitudinally extending top and bottom beams which form the juncture between the side walls and the top wall, and the side walls and the bottom wall, respectively. Because all elements of the trailer side walls are rigidly joined to the top and bottom beams, the overall strength and rigidity of the trailer is increased.
Abstract:
A generally horseshoe shaped inventory restraining device of a unitary and resilient construction comprising two arms extending from a base and having inner walls which define a longitudinally extending re-entrant cavity therebetween for clipping onto and tight securement to a rod-like merchandise display hook. A method is presented for using the device in conjunction with the merchandise display hook.
Abstract:
Marker devices, each comprising a base with an upright post thereon, are molded from an elastomeric material. A marker device is attached by adhesive on the base thereof to each paint striping on a worn down street and each maintenance cover mounted on the worn down street. Once the marker devices are in place on the worn down street, the posts thereof must withstand the punishment of not only being flattened by truck tires, and the tracts of a paving machine that is being used to lay down the new coating of hot asphalt on the worn down street, but also the hot asphalt, and still spring back to their upright position. Thus, when the stripings are to be repainted on the resurfaced street and when the maintenance covers are to be adjusted upwardly to the level of the new coating of asphalt on the resurfaced street their exact locations on the street are immediately indicated by the posts of the marker devices without having to make any measurements.
